The Importance of Due Diligence in Partner Selection
Before entering into any financial partnership, conducting thorough due diligence is absolutely critical. This process involves a comprehensive evaluation of the potential partner’s financial stability, track record, and ethical standards. Investigating their past performance, client testimonials, and regulatory compliance is essential to mitigating risk. Furthermore, it’s important to clearly define the terms of the partnership, including roles, responsibilities, and profit-sharing arrangements. Legal counsel should be engaged to ensure that all agreements are legally sound and protect the interests of both parties. Skipping this step can lead to costly mistakes and potential legal disputes down the line. A well-defined agreement serves as a roadmap for a successful and mutually beneficial relationship.
| Partnership Aspect | Due Diligence Checklist |
|---|---|
| Financial Stability | Review financial statements, credit reports, and independent audits. |
| Track Record | Examine past projects, client successes, and industry reputation. |
| Regulatory Compliance | Verify licenses, permits, and adherence to relevant regulations. |
| Legal Review | Engage legal counsel to review partnership agreements. |

Optimizing Capital Structure for Long-Term Financial Health
A robust capital structure is the foundation of long-term financial health. It’s about strategically blending different sources of funding – debt, equity, and retained earnings – to minimize costs and maximize returns. Optimizing your capital structure requires careful consideration of several factors, including your business’s risk profile, growth potential, and market conditions. Overreliance on debt can increase financial vulnerability, while excessive equity dilution can diminish ownership control. Finding the right balance is crucial for achieving sustainable growth. Regularly reviewing and adjusting your capital structure will ensure it remains aligned with evolving business needs and market dynamics.
The Role of Debt and Equity Financing
Debt financing involves borrowing money from lenders, while equity financing involves selling ownership shares in your company. Each approach has its own advantages and disadvantages. Debt financing offers the benefit of retaining ownership control, but it comes with the obligation to repay the principal amount plus interest. Equity financing doesn’t require repayment, but it dilutes ownership and may involve sharing profits with investors. The optimal financing strategy will depend on your specific circumstances and risk tolerance. For example, a rapidly growing company with high cash flow may be able to comfortably service debt, while a startup with limited revenue may be better off seeking equity funding. A thorough financial analysis is crucial for making informed decisions.
- Assess Financial Needs: Determine the amount of funding required.
- Evaluate Financing Options: Compare debt and equity financing alternatives.
- Develop a Financial Model: Project future cash flows and assess debt repayment capacity.
- Negotiate Terms: Secure favorable terms with lenders or investors.
Carefully considering these steps can help businesses choose the financing option that best supports their long-term objectives.
Navigating Regulatory Landscapes for Investment Compliance
The world of finance is heavily regulated, and navigating the complex legal landscape is essential for ensuring investment compliance. Failure to adhere to relevant regulations can result in hefty fines, legal penalties, and reputational damage. A comprehensive understanding of securities laws, anti-money laundering regulations, and data privacy requirements is crucial. Businesses must establish robust compliance programs and invest in ongoing training for their employees. Seeking guidance from experienced legal counsel and compliance professionals is highly recommended. Staying informed about changes in regulations is also vital, as the legal landscape is constantly evolving.
Furthermore, maintaining meticulous records and documenting all financial transactions is essential for demonstrating compliance. Regular audits and internal controls can help identify and address potential vulnerabilities. A proactive approach to compliance isn’t just about avoiding penalties; it’s about building trust with investors and stakeholders. Transparency and accountability are key principles of responsible financial management.
